International Mother Language Day 2021
International Mother Language Day 2021
Understanding the Importance of Languages for Identities and Communities
The International Mother Language Day was designated by the General Conference of the United Nations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ization (UNESCO) in 2002. This OSU event has been organized to celebrate International Mother Language Day 2021 and the importance of mother languages & linguistic diversity. It will feature a panel made up of graduate students who are mother tongue speakers of minority and indigenous languages. This event is co-sponsored by the T&L DECo, Foreign Language Research & Teaching student group, and the EHE EDGE Office.
Panel moderator: Peter Sayer
Panel members:
Susan Ataei (Iran, Azerbaijani)
Emre Basok (Turkey, Circassian)
Elena Costello Tzintzun (U.S., Spanish)
Santiago Gualapuro (Ecuador, Kichwa)
